$199 Million Recovered from Retail Thieves in 2013
Almost 1.2 million shoplifters and dishonest employees were apprehended in 2013 by just 23 large retailers. Over $199 million was recovered from these thieves, according to the 26th Annual Retail Theft Survey from Jack L. Hayes International.
The number of apprehensions and recovery dollars were up in 2013 – 2.5-percent increases in apprehensions and 4.5-percent increases in recovery dollars for shoplifters, and 6.5- and 2.5-percent increases respectively for dishonest employees.
